"Transfiguration" was inspired by a Buddhist teaching of Right Effort. The figure, strong and confident, is balancing between an old world order and the freedom and expansiveness of a new path. This piece could be interpreted as an allegory for personal transformation, the shedding of old ideas, and the embrace of change. The use of a cool palette interspersed with warm tones accentuates the sense of emerging into a new state of being.
"Transfiguration" is from the series, “Untangling Our Roots”, which explores the evolution from childhood beliefs and cultural influences to developing a unique path and voice as an adult. Each painting in the series addresses a different universal struggle and is infused with a solitary figure, enigmatic nature as a healing and guiding force, and/or spiritual and cultural symbolism. This series strives to embody mystery, beauty, exploration, and discovery.
